fix NPE related to recent RichIMM changes

This commit is contained in:
Helium314 2025-05-31 14:28:02 +02:00
parent c321c2c684
commit e4e99a7e5d

View file

@ -31,7 +31,7 @@ object SubtypeSettings {
return enabledSubtypes
}
fun isEnabled(subtype: InputMethodSubtype): Boolean = subtype in enabledSubtypes || subtype in getDefaultEnabledSubtypes()
fun isEnabled(subtype: InputMethodSubtype?): Boolean = subtype in enabledSubtypes || subtype in getDefaultEnabledSubtypes()
fun getAllAvailableSubtypes(): List<InputMethodSubtype> =
resourceSubtypesByLocale.values.flatten() + additionalSubtypes